Hundreds Demand Urgent Improvements to Cheltenham-Gloucester Bus Service

More than 750 residents have signed a petition calling for significant improvements to the 97/98 bus service that connects Churchdown and Innsworth with Cheltenham and Gloucester.

The petition, presented at Shire Hall on March 25, urges Stagecoach to conduct a thorough review of the service and address ongoing reliability issues that have left passengers frustrated.

Gloucestershire County Councillor Stewart Dove, representing Churchdown and Innsworth, collaborated with Sarah Hands, Tewkesbury Borough Council representative for Innsworth and Highnam at Shire Hall, to launch the petition. They emphasize that the community deserves a dependable service tailored to its needs, with particular focus on efficient connections to Cheltenham.

“We are increasingly concerned about the deteriorating state of our local public transport, especially the 97/98 Stagecoach bus route,” the Liberal Democrat councillors stated in the petition.

“The reliability of this essential service has seriously declined, causing major inconvenience, particularly for morning journeys to school and work. Too often, buses fail to arrive on time, leaving children and commuters stranded.

“In September 2023, route changes to and from Cheltenham significantly increased journey times, adding to daily commuter frustration. These alterations were implemented without prior community consultation.

“A reliable transportation system is vital for everyone, and right now, it’s failing our community.”

The petition stresses that immediate action is needed.

“Improving the 97/98 bus service will ensure it meets the community’s travel needs reliably, providing peace of mind to schoolchildren, workers, and essential travellers alike,” it concludes.

Stagecoach has been contacted for comment.
